一个简单的监控redis性能的python脚本

#!/usr/bin/env python  # -*- coding: utf-8 -*-
  __author__ = 'chenmingle'
  import sys
  import subprocess
  import json
  try:
  import redis
  except Exception, e:
  print 'pip install redis'
  sys.exit(1)
  class Redis(object):
  def __init__(self, host, port, password=None):
  self.host = host
  self.port = port
  self.password = password
  if self.password:
  self.rds = redis.StrictRedis(host=host, port=port, password=self.password)
  else:
  self.rds = redis.StrictRedis(host=host, port=port)
  try:
  self.info = self.rds.info()
  except Exception, e:
  self.info = None
  def redis_connections(self):
  try:
  return self.info['connected_clients']
  except Exception, e:
  return 0
  def redis_connections_usage(self):
  try:
  curr_connections = self.redis_connections()
  max_clients = self.parse_config('maxclients')
  rate = float(curr_connections) / float(max_clients)
  return "%.2f" % (rate * 100)
  except Exception, e:
  return 0
  def redis_used_memory(self):
  try:
  return self.info['used_memory']
  except Exception, e:
  return 0
  def redis_memory_usage(self):
  try:
  used_memory = self.info['used_memory']
  max_memory = self.info['maxmemory']
  system_memory = self.info['total_system_memory']
  if max_memory:
  rate = float(used_memory) / float(max_memory)
  else:
  rate = float(used_memory) / float(system_memory)
  return "%.2f" % (rate * 100)
  except Exception, e:
  return 0
  def redis_ping(self):
  try:
  return self.rds.ping()
  except Exception, e:
  return False
  def rejected_connections(self):
  try:
  return self.info['rejected_connections']
  except Exception, e:
  return 999
  def evicted_keys(self):
  try:
  return self.info['evicted_keys']
  except Exception, e:
  return 999
  def blocked_clients(self):
  try:
  return self.info['blocked_clients']
  except Exception, e:
  return 0
  def ops(self):
  try:
  return self.info['instantaneous_ops_per_sec']
  except Exception, e:
  return 0
  def hitRate(self):
  try:
  misses = self.info['keyspace_misses']
  hits = self.info['keyspace_hits']
  rate = float(hits) / float(int(hits) + int(misses))
  return "%.2f" % (rate * 100)
  except Exception, e:
  return 0
  def parse_config(self, type):
  try:
  return self.rds.config_get(type)
  except Exception, e:
  return None
  def test(self):
  print 'Redis ping: %s' % self.redis_ping()
  print 'Redis alive: %s ' % check_alive(self.host, self.port)
  print 'Redis connections: %s' % self.redis_connections()
  print 'Redis blockedClients %s' % self.blocked_clients()
  print 'Redis connectionsUsage: %s%%' % self.redis_connections_usage()
  print 'Redis memoryUsage: %s' % self.redis_used_memory()
  print 'Redis memoryUsageRate: %s%%' % self.redis_memory_usage()
  print 'Redis evictedKeys: %s' % self.evicted_keys()
  print 'Redis rejectedConnections: %s' % self.rejected_connections()
  print 'Redis ops: %s' % self.ops()
  print 'Redis hitRate: %s%%' % self.hitRate()
  def check_alive(host, port):
  cmd = 'nc -z %s %s > /dev/null 2>&1' % (host, port)
  return subprocess.call(cmd, shell=True)
  def parse(type, host, port, password):
  rds = Redis(host, port, password)
  if type == 'connections':
  print rds.redis_connections()
  elif type == 'connectionsUsage':
  print rds.redis_connections_usage()
  elif type == 'blockedClients':
  print rds.blocked_clients()
  elif type == 'ping':
  print rds.redis_ping()
  elif type == 'alive':
  print check_alive(host, port)
  elif type == 'memoryUsage':
  print rds.redis_used_memory()
  elif type == 'memoryUsageRate':
  print rds.redis_memory_usage()
  elif type == 'rejectedConnections':
  print rds.rejected_connections()
  elif type == 'evictedKeys':
  print rds.evicted_keys()
  elif type == 'hitRate':
  print rds.hitRate()
  elif type == 'ops':
  print rds.ops()
  else:
  rds.test()
  if __name__ == '__main__':
  try:
  type = sys.argv
  host = sys.argv
  port = sys.argv
  if sys.argv.__len__() >=5:
  password = sys.argv
  else:
  password = None
  except Exception, e:
  print "Usage: python %s type 127.0.0.1 6379" % sys.argv
  sys.exit(1)
  parse(type, host, port, password)
